Institute of Climate-Smart Agriculture of the National Academy of Agrarian Sciences of Ukraine (NAAS)

Institute of Climate-Smart Agriculture of the National Academy of Agrarian Sciences of Ukraine (NAAS) is a leading research institution that addresses critical strategic objectives of the country - performing fundamental and applied research on agriculture in the face of climate change and thus making a significant contribution to the food security of Ukraine and other countries. The Institute was formed by the merger of powerful scientific institutions in the South of Ukraine: The Institute of Irrigated Agriculture, the Institute of Rice, and the Southern State Agricultural Experimental Station for Vegetable and Melon Growing.

It is a leading research institution that addresses our country's critical strategic tasks, including ensuring food security in Ukraine and other countries.

Office premises and modern scientific laboratories were destroyed, agricultural machinery was looted, and the seed bank was destroyed. In addition, a valuable library collection was partially burned, and laboratory and computer equipment was stolen. The roof of the building was damaged by indirect shelling and all windows were smashed.
